## Changelog — Ticktrace 1.9

### Renamed: DRIFT_API_TOKEN
During the cron drift investigation we found plugins confusing this variable with the metrics token, so it has been renamed to indicate it authorizes drift-report uploads specifically. Plugin authors must read the new name from 1.9 onward; the old name is ignored without warning. Sample env files in the SDK are updated. In your deployment env file, the drift-report upload secret is set on the next line.

env line for fawef-taguf: VAULT_KEY13=a9695905a9a90

## Deploying the Gatewick Proctor Queue

Deploys are pretty painless: push to main, wait for the pipeline, then watch the queue drain dashboard for five minutes. If candidates pile up mid-exam, roll back first and ask questions later — the queue replays safely. Everything the workers care about lives in one config block, shown here for reference.

settings of bafof-yagef:
JOROX_PIN=8740
JOROX_TENANT=pelox
JOROX_METRICS_HOST=metrics.jorox.qorvelworks.internal
JOROX_SEAL=seal_c78f63c1
JOROX_STANDBY_TEAM=norax

Ticket: Config drift on Squintel scanner nodes

During routine review I found that three scanner nodes in the Harlow cluster no longer match the declared baseline: their similarity threshold and registry polling interval were changed manually, likely during last month's incident. Please restore the declared state and confirm alerts resume. For reference, the intended baseline values are as follows.

deployment values, kajep-kageg:
[praix]
host = praix.paliqcorp.corp
user = praix_svc
database = praix_prod

TURN-208: Gatevale turnstile counters at the Merrow Field pilot double-count when a rotation reverses mid-cycle. Attendance totals drift roughly 2% high per event. The debounce window fix is implemented, reviewed by Ilsa, and soak-tested across two simulated match days without drift. Ready for your cut; the candidate build is identified below.

trace token, tagag-tafog: htk6_5ed18c